We cannot let this happen! We mustn't allow this beautiful wooded area full of native trees and protected wildlife to be just torn down with no reason! This woodland is home to bats, badgers, Pygmy shrews, hedgehogs and buzzards! These animals are protected in Ireland and it is illegal to destroy theses beautiful creatures homes! There are 200 year old oak trees which are perfectly healthy!Please sign the petition to stop the tree felling licence application GFL16380! Which is to remove 70% of the woodland along the Termonfeckin Road which is in Newtownstalaban across from the Newtown Cross Cemetery.
